SUMMARY

Healthy Steps, a program of Zero to Three, promotes nurturing caregiving, which supports families and improves healthy development and well-being of babies and toddlers, preparing them for school and life. The Healthy Steps Specialist is an early child development expert who will join the pediatric primary care team to provide interventions, referrals, and follow-up for families with patients’ ages 0-5. The Healthy Steps Specialist builds strong relationships with families and providers to increase the efficiency of the medical system and support team-based comprehensive care.

Responsibilities

  • Promotes the Healthy Steps program and supports families through team-based well-child visits focused on development, behavior, and relational health.
  • Provides short-term consultations on common early childhood concerns and maintains a support line for developmental questions.
  • Connects families with community resources by managing a referral database, tracking follow-ups, and maintaining updated directories.
  • Collaborates closely with primary care and maternal-child teams, participates in ongoing training, supervision, and documents all clinical activities in the EMR.
